来源:小编 更新:2024-11-16 12:26:39
用手机看
原子组件,顾名思义,是构成复杂系统的基础单元。在软件工程和用户界面设计中,原子组件指的是最基本的、不可再分的UI元素。它们是构建更复杂组件和用户界面(UI)的基础,类似于化学中的原子是构成分子的基础单元。
原子组件具有以下特点:
基础性:原子组件是最基础的UI元素,如按钮、输入框、开关、图标等。
不可分割:它们是不可再分的,即不能进一步拆分成更小的组件。
通用性:原子组件适用于多种不同的场景和业务,具有广泛的适用性。
一致性:使用原子组件可以保证设计的一致性,提升用户体验。
界面构建:通过组合不同的原子组件,可以快速构建出复杂的用户界面。
设计系统:在构建设计系统时,原子组件是设计语言的核心组成部分。
前端开发:前端开发者使用原子组件来构建网页和移动应用的用户界面。
用户体验:通过统一和标准化的原子组件,可以提升用户体验的一致性和便捷性。
原子组件可以根据其功能和用途分为以下几类:
布局元素:如网格、容器、间距、对齐等。
交互元素:如下拉菜单、日期选择器、滑块等。
状态元素:如加载指示器、进度条、提示框等。
原子组件与业务组件是两个不同的概念。原子组件是基础性的UI元素,而业务组件则是在原子组件的基础上构建的,具有特定业务功能的组件。
原子组件:如按钮、输入框等,是构成业务组件的基础。
业务组件:如表单、表格、图表等,是针对特定业务需求设计的组件。
在设计原子组件时,应遵循以下原则:
一致性:确保所有原子组件的风格和用法保持一致。
可访问性:确保原子组件符合可访问性标准,方便所有用户使用。
可维护性:设计易于维护和扩展的原子组件。
可复用性:确保原子组件可以在多个项目中复用。
原子组件是构建现代软件和用户界面的基石。通过合理设计和使用原子组件,可以提升开发效率、保证设计一致性,并最终提升用户体验。了解原子组件的概念、特点和应用,对于从事UI设计、前端开发等相关工作的人员来说至关重要。